Recently, the black acid reuse project at the R&D institute of Fushun Petrochemical Company achieved a key milestone, managing to convert the waste black acid into metal detergent products. Pyrosulfuric acid is a by-product of the sulfonation process in the detergent manufacturing plants, used to produce alkylbenzene sulfonic acid; it consists of 60% sulfonic acid, 20% persulfonates, and 10% waste sulfuric acid. For a long time, due to its complex composition and corrosive nature, it has been disposed of as hazardous liquid waste. To achieve comprehensive utilization of pyrogallol, the special oils development team at the research institute held in-depth discussions with researchers from Beitian Group to explore ways to reuse pyrogallol waste. During the project implementation, the development team conducted several experiments based on the properties of the raw materials. By addressing the issue of harmless treatment of waste sulfuric acid in pyrogallol, they made full use of the sulfonic acid components present in pyrogallol, as well as additives such as EDTA and OP-10, to improve the product’s stability at high and low temperatures, its foaming properties, and its cleaning power. As a result, a product that meets the standards of the metal detergent industry was successfully developed. Currently, the project is carrying out industrial trial production and the promotion of subsequent products. This product is expected to be used for equipment cleaning during the major maintenance of Fushun Petrochemical Company’s facilities in 2025, thereby reducing the costs associated with purchasing industrial cleaning agents.
